The Steep Slope of Resale Value


The Poco C50 is a budget-tier smartphone featuring a 5000 mAh battery for multi-day endurance and a 6.52-inch IPS LCD for essential media consumption, aimed at ultra-budget-conscious buyers. Released in early 2023, it competes with the Redmi A1+ and various entry-level offerings from Realme and Samsung's A-series.

We analyze the financial trajectory of the Poco C50 as an asset. In the secondary market, sub-$100 devices typically suffer the most aggressive depreciation curves. Because the initial purchase price is roughly 80 EUR, the resale window is narrow. After twelve months of usage, we predict this handset will retain less than 40% of its original MSRP. Unlike flagship devices that hold value through brand prestige, this model is a utility tool. It's designed for a high-usage, low-care lifecycle where the cost-per-day of ownership is the only metric that matters. At its current price, the device costs approximately 0.11 EUR per day over a projected two-year lifespan.

The eMMC 5.1 storage standard further complicates the long-term valuation. eMMC 5.1 is an integrated storage standard providing standardized data transfer protocols for cost-effective mobile devices. It serves as an entry-level alternative to the faster UFS standards found in [mid-range phones](/trend/best-mid-range-phones-2026/). Over time, eMMC storage tends to degrade in read/write speeds faster than UFS, meaning the device will likely feel significantly slower by its second anniversary. This planned obsolescence is a calculated trade-off for the rock-bottom entry price. Owners should view this as a 'run-to-fail' asset rather than a trade-in candidate.

Evaluating the Brand Heritage


Poco has built a reputation on 'performance at all costs,' but the Poco C50 shifts that focus to 'reliability at the lowest cost.' We see the Xiaomi DNA in the manufacturing quality. Even though the price is low, the assembly feels tight. There are no obvious gaps in the chassis, and the leather-like texture on the plastic back plate provides a grip that minimizes accidental drops. This is a crucial economic factor; a phone that survives a drop without a repair bill is inherently more valuable than a more expensive, fragile alternative.

The brand's choice to use Android 12 (Go edition) is a strategic move for reliability. Android Go is a lightweight version of the operating system designed specifically for devices with low RAM. By stripping out heavy background processes, the software ensures that the quad-core Helio A22 chipset doesn't choke on basic system updates. We find that this software-to-hardware alignment is the primary reason the device remains functional for daily communication tasks like WhatsApp and Lite versions of social media apps.

Visual Assets and Auditory Reality


The 6.52-inch IPS LCD provides a 720 x 1600 resolution. In our assessment, the 269 ppi density is the minimum acceptable standard for 2023. Text appears legible, though you will notice soft edges on high-contrast icons. The 400 nits of brightness represent a significant hurdle for outdoor visibility. Under direct midday sunlight, the display struggles to overcome glare. We recommend this handset for users who primarily operate in indoor or shaded environments.

Audio is delivered via a single loudspeaker. The separation is non-existent, and the profile is heavily biased toward the mid-range frequencies. However, the inclusion of a 3.5mm headphone jack is a major value-add. For many in this price segment, the ability to use inexpensive wired earbuds is a financial necessity. The device functions as a capable pocket radio or basic media player, provided you aren't expecting a cinematic soundstage.

Compare this to the Samsung Galaxy A04. While Samsung offers a slightly more vibrant display profile, it often lacks the rear-mounted fingerprint sensor found on the higher-tier Poco C50 variants. The Poco C50 prioritizes functional security over aesthetic screen calibration, which we believe is the correct economic choice for the target demographic.

Hardware Barriers: Security and Biometrics


Security is handled by a rear-mounted fingerprint sensor. In an era where many [budget phones](/trend/best-budget-phones-2026/) are moving to side-mounted sensors or abandoning them entirely for insecure face unlock, this hardware choice is commendable. The sensor provides a tactile physical anchor on the back of the device. Our tests indicate a consistent, if slightly leisurely, unlock speed of approximately 0.5 to 0.8 seconds. It is reliable, which prevents the frustration of repetitive failed attempts.

The device also features virtual proximity sensing. This is a software-based solution that uses the accelerometer and other internal sensors to mimic a physical proximity sensor. While this saves on hardware costs, it can occasionally lead to the screen turning on during a phone call if the phone isn't held at a specific angle. We consider this a minor annoyance rather than a dealbreaker, but it illustrates where the cost-cutting measures are located.

The Signal Economy: Bandwidth and Logistics


The Poco C50 supports LTE bands 1, 3, 5, 8, 40, and 41. In the context of the Indian and European markets, this covers all major carriers with reliable signal penetration. The Wi-Fi 802.11 b/g/n support is limited to the 2.4GHz band. We noticed that in congested apartment environments, the 2.4GHz band can lead to slower download speeds and higher latency compared to dual-band 5GHz Wi-Fi. If you rely on high-speed home internet, the phone will be a bottleneck.

The use of microUSB 2.0 in 2023 is the most significant logistical drawback. microUSB 2.0 is an older data and power connection standard characterized by its asymmetrical connector. With the world rapidly moving to USB Type-C, users will find themselves carrying a legacy cable specifically for this phone. From a value perspective, this increases the 'hassle factor' and limits the ability to share chargers with friends or family members using modern hardware.

Charging at 10W wired is a slow process for a 5000 mAh battery. Expect a full charge to take nearly three hours. Imagine you are in a rush and only have 15 minutes to charge; you will only gain about 8-10% battery life. This phone requires a 'charge-while-you-sleep' routine. The trade-off is that the slow charging likely preserves the health of the lithium-polymer cells over a longer period compared to aggressive fast-charging solutions.

Software Longevity and the Android Go Gamble


The Helio A22 chipset is a quad-core 12nm processor. While it handles the Android Go interface with acceptable fluidity, it cannot handle modern mobile gaming or heavy multitasking. Picture a user trying to run Google Maps while simultaneously taking a phone call and checking a browser; the 2GB or 3GB of RAM will quickly hit its limit, causing background apps to close. This phone is built for sequential tasks, not simultaneous ones.

The PowerVR GE8320 GPU is optimized for UI transitions rather than 3D rendering. Attempting to play resource-heavy games will result in significant frame drops and heat build-up. However, for the 'economist' user, this limitation is actually a benefit for battery life. Because the hardware isn't capable of pushing high performance, the 5000 mAh battery easily stretches into a second day of light usage. This endurance is the device's primary selling point.

The Final Accounting: A Practical Investment Analysis


The Poco C50 represents the floor of the smartphone market in January 2023. It avoids the 'trash' category by including a reliable fingerprint sensor, a large battery, and a clean (albeit light) version of Android. It is not an 'aspirational' device. It is a tool for communication and basic information access.

For a student or a delivery driver who needs a secondary device that won't die mid-shift, the Poco C50 is a logical purchase. For anyone expecting to use this as their primary 'everything' device for the next three years, the lack of 5G, the microUSB port, and the limited RAM will become frustrating bottlenecks within the first six months. This is a short-to-medium term investment in basic connectivity.
